What is the role of RJ45 with transformer?

In an Ethernet device, when the PHY is connected to the RJ45 with a transformer, the base adds a network transformer. Some transformer bases are connected to the power supply, and some are connected to the ground. And when connected to the power supply, the power supply value can be different, 3.3V, 2.5V, 1.8V. What is the effect of this transformer?


Here is an approximate answer:


1. Why is the base tap connected to the power supply? Some grounding? This is primarily the resolution of the UTP port drive type used with the PHY chip. There are two types of drive, voltage drive and current drive. The voltage drive should be connected to the power supply; if the current is driven, it can be connected directly to the ground! So with regard to different chips, the connection of the base tap is closely related to the PHY. For details, please refer to the chip's datasheet and refer to the planning. 2. Why do you connect different voltages when you connect the power supply? This is also the regular UTP port level resolution in the PHY chip material used. The level of the resolution, you have to pick up the corresponding voltage. That is, if it is 2.5v, it will be pulled up to 2.5v, and if it is 3.3v, it will be pulled up to 3.3v. 3. What is the effect of this transformer? Can you not pick it up? In theory, it can be connected to the RJ45 without the need for a transformer, and it can work normally. However, the transmission interval is very limited, and it will also have an impact when connected to a different level network port. And the external interference on the chip is also very large. When connected to a network transformer, it is primarily used for signal level coupling. First, it can enhance the signal to make the transmission interval farther; secondly, the chip end and the external barrier can be greatly enhanced, and the anti-interference can be greatly enhanced, and the maintenance effect (such as lightning strike) is added to the chip; When the network port is not the same level (if the PHY chip is 2.5V and some PHY chips are 3.3V), it will not affect the mutual devices. In general, network transformers have the effects of signal transmission, impedance matching, waveform correction, signal clutter suppression, and high voltage blocking.
